George A. Miller (1920–2012) was an influential American psychologist known for his groundbreaking work in cognitive psychology. He is best remembered for his discovery of the "Magical Number 7," which refers to the idea that the average number of objects an individual can hold in their working memory is about seven. This insight significantly shaped our understanding of memory and cognition. Miller was a key figure in the development of cognitive psychology, advocating for the study of mental processes like perception, memory, and problem-solving. His contributions also helped bridge the gap between psychology and linguistics, influencing fields like artificial intelligence and cognitive science.
